When supply increases, prices tend to decrease, as there is more of the good or service available. Conversely, when supply decreases, prices tend to increase, as there is less of the good or service available.
Supply refers to the total amount of a particular good or service that producers are willing and able to produce and sell at a given price level. It's influenced by various factors, including:

Myth: Supply is always fixed
Myth: Supply is solely determined by demand
